Management Commentary

During the public earnings call held to discuss the the previous quarter results, Femasys leadership provided context for the quarterly financial performance, noting that the lack of revenue is expected for the company’s current stage of growth, as it has not yet launched full commercial sales of any of its lead product candidates. Management emphasized that the company’s priority during the quarter was advancing key clinical trial milestones for its flagship offerings, including enrollment expansion for late-stage trials of its non-surgical diagnostic and treatment devices for common women’s health conditions. All shared commentary reflects public statements made during the official earnings call, with no fabricated statements attributed to company leadership. Management also noted that the company’s cash burn rate during the quarter was in line with internal projections, and that available capital reserves are sufficient to support planned operational activities for the foreseeable future, per official public disclosures. Forward Guidance

Femasys did not issue specific quantitative financial guidance for future periods, consistent with its standard practice as a clinical-stage firm with unpredictable commercial launch timelines. Instead, management outlined key operational milestones that the company will target in the near term, including completion of enrollment for ongoing late-stage clinical trials, submission of regulatory filings to relevant global health authorities for its lead candidates, and preliminary commercial readiness planning for potential product launches pending regulatory approval. Analysts tracking FEMY note that progress against these milestones could potentially shift the company’s financial trajectory in future periods, though regulatory review timelines and clinical trial outcomes carry inherent uncertainty that may alter projected timelines. No commitments around future revenue or profitability were shared by leadership during the call. Market Reaction

Following the release of the the previous quarter earnings results, trading activity in FEMY shares remained in line with average historical volume levels, with no extreme intraday price volatility observed in the sessions immediately after the announcement, based on public market trading data. Most sell-side analysts covering the stock have maintained their existing research coverage ratings following the earnings print, as the reported results were largely aligned with prior market expectations. Market participants are expected to continue monitoring updates on Femasys’ clinical trial progress and regulatory submission timelines in the coming months, as these non-financial milestones will likely be the primary drivers of investor sentiment toward the stock for the foreseeable future. As a pre-revenue development stage firm, FEMY’s valuation is tied primarily to market perceptions of the likelihood of successful regulatory approval and commercial adoption of its product candidates, rather than near-term financial performance metrics.
